keep a promise, do what one promised

listen to the pronunciation of keep a promise, do what one promised
الإنجليزية - التركية

تعريف keep a promise, do what one promised في الإنجليزية التركية القاموس.

keep one's word
(deyim) sozunu tutmak
keep one's word
sözünü tutmak
الإنجليزية - الإنجليزية
keep one's word
keep a promise, do what one promised
المفضلات